VIGNOBLE LA GRANDE VIGNE's Pinot Noir is a testament to the grape’s challenging yet rewarding nature, with its rich history dating back to Burgundy. As one of the most demanding red grapes, it demands careful cultivation and yields wines that are lighter in color and tannin compared to more robust varietals like Cabernet Sauvignon or Syrah. Expect aromas of red cherry, raspberry, rose petal, earth, mushroom, and forest floor, with potential for intricate secondary and tertiary notes as the wine ages. Perfectly paired with a variety of dishes, from salmon and duck to lightly spiced cuisines, this Pinot Noir offers versatility at table.
